Step 1: Emergency Board-Up and Damage Control

We start by securing the property with emergency board-up services to protect it from the elements, trespassers, and further damage. If the roof, windows, or doors have been compromised, we’ll seal off the area to keep it safe while we assess the next steps.

This phase is critical in preventing additional loss while insurance claims are being processed.

Step 2: Content Pack-Out and Inventory

Next, we remove and protect your personal belongings. Our content pack-out service carefully documents and transports salvageable items for cleaning and storage. We also provide a detailed inventory of damaged items to support your insurance claim.

Step 3: Smoke and Odor Removal

One of the most difficult parts of fire restoration is getting rid of the lingering smell of smoke. Ehlers Construction uses professional-grade equipment and techniques to eliminate smoke odors at the source.

Our smoke and odor removal process includes:

  • Thermal fogging to neutralize deep smoke particles in walls, ceilings, and insulation
  • Ozone treatment to destroy odor-causing molecules in the air and porous materials
  • Air scrubbing with HEPA filters to remove lingering particulates
  • Sealing of surfaces, if needed, to block stubborn odors

We don’t just mask the smell. We eliminate it.

Step 4: Water and Soot Cleanup

Most fires also involve some level of water damage from firefighting efforts. Our team handles both problems at once, removing standing water, drying out affected materials, and cleaning soot from walls, ceilings, floors, and ductwork.

This step helps prevent mold growth and structural decay down the line.

Fire Safety Starts at Home A house fire can be devastating, but many causes are preventable with regular upkeep and awareness. Here are a few things every homeowner should stay on top of: Check your fire extinguishers — Make sure they’re not expired and stored in accessible areas like kitchens and garages. Inspect outlets and appliances — Look for frayed cords, overloaded power strips, and outdated electrical systems. Keep cooking areas clear — Never leave food unattended on the stove, and avoid storing flammable items near heat sources. The Hidden Danger of Water Damage Water damage often goes unnoticed until it becomes a major (and expensive) problem. Slow leaks, overflows, and poor drainage can all lead to structural damage, mold growth, and even health concerns. Key ways to reduce your risk: Keep an eye on bubbling paint, warped floors, or musty smells — These are common signs of water hiding behind walls. Know where your water shut-off is — A fast response can limit damage during a burst pipe or overflowing toilet. Clean gutters and downspouts regularly — Proper drainage keeps water away from your foundation. Prevention saves money — and stress. Here are the top mistakes homeowners make after water damage—and how our experienced team helps fix them. 1. Waiting Too Long to Act Time is critical. Water seeps into floors, walls, and insulation within minutes—and mold can begin growing within 24-48 hours. One of the biggest mistakes is waiting to call a professional, either out of shock or thinking the damage is minor. At Ehlers Construction, we respond quickly to water damage in Eugene, OR, with fast extraction and drying solutions to minimize long-term impact. 2. Attempting DIY Cleanup Without Proper Tools Shop vacs and box fans can’t reach hidden moisture trapped in subfloors, drywall, or structural framing. DIY cleanup often leaves behind water that leads to mold, odor, and rot. Our water damage restoration team in Eugene uses industrial-grade equipment to remove moisture thoroughly and restore your home safely and efficiently. 3. Ignoring Signs of Structural Damage Water weakens structural materials over time. Sagging ceilings, warped floors, and soft drywall are all red flags—but many homeowners overlook them in the rush to clean up. Ehlers Construction performs complete structural assessments to ensure your home is stable and safe before repairs begin. 4. Using Household Cleaners That Can Worsen the Damage Some cleaning products are not designed for water damage or mold. They may bleach surfaces or cause chemical reactions that worsen the damage. We use safe, specialized cleaning solutions that disinfect, deodorize, and preserve materials wherever possible. 5. Incomplete Insurance Documentation Filing a water damage insurance claim can be overwhelming. Many homeowners forget to document everything properly—resulting in denied or underpaid claims.
